The street in brief

Sales on Flower Court are mostly flats. The median sale price is £128,000, about 65% below the typical CV37 sale.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£4,231, above the district's £3,729.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; CV37 prices as a whole have been easing. HM Land Registry records 9 sales across 6 homes since 2001 — homes here come up rarely.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
